High Bias
by Marc Masters

ISBN: 9781469675985
Softcover, new

Brief Description:
“Marc Masters explores the surprising ups and downs of the cassette tape’s
journey through international music culture, showing us the cultural impact
of cassettes on music listening, music portability, and music making
itself. Winding through early hip-hop tape trading, the deeply personal act
of making a mixtape, and even contemporary composers who use cassettes to
create musique concrète compositions, this book chronicles the resilient
do-it-yourself spirit of cassettes through conversations with scene-setters
coupled with deep explorations into music history. More than just the most
comprehensive history of how cassettes have changed music, this is also a
vivid tribute to a format that refuses to fade away”–
